Fiery Clash Ends in a Draw Between Al Wasl and Al Ain!
A draw prevails between Al Wasl and Al Ain (Photo/UAE Pro League)
SHARE

Dubai, UAE – A thrilling 1-1 draw settled the Round 3 clash of the ADNOC Pro League between Al Wasl and visitors Al Ain on Saturday evening at Zabeel Stadium.

Al Wasl took the lead early in the second half through Brazilian star Serginho in the 47th minute. Then, Laba Kodjo leveled the score for Al Ain in the 58th. With this result, Al Wasl raised their tally to 4 points in eighth place. Meanwhile, Al Ain reached 7 points to remain in second.

The match saw end-to-end action. Palacios came close to opening the scoring for Al Ain in the 3rd minute with a powerful strike that narrowly missed the post. Al Wasl replied in the 33rd minute with a dangerous chance that was denied by Khalid Essa. In stoppage time of the first half, goalkeeper Mohammed Ali produced a stunning save to deny Palacios once again.

Just two minutes into the second half, Serginho netted the opener for Al Wasl with a fine finish. However, Kodjo brought Al Ain back with a well-taken strike inside the box.

Al Wasl thought they had regained the lead in the 65th minute through Matheus Saldanha’s header, but the goal was disallowed for offside. Moments later, Al Ain’s Traoré fired a rocket from outside the area in the 71st minute. Yet, Mohammed Ali held firm.

The battle remained fierce until the final whistle, as both sides settled for a point apiece in a captivating encounter.
